Vanessa Russo: A Multifaceted Success Story

vanessa-rousso

Early Years and Diverse Talents

Vanessa Russo, a successful and versatile personality, has captivated audiences not only in the world of poker but also in various other pursuits. From an early age, she displayed a multitude of interests, engaging in basketball, swimming, lacrosse, and even mastering the violin. Remarkably, Vanessa grasped the rules of poker at the tender age of 5.

Academic Brilliance and a Twist of Destiny

A quick learner, Vanessa excelled in academics, graduating with honors from school. She further demonstrated her intellectual prowess by completing her economics degree at Duke University in just 2.5 years. Initially planning a legal career, Vanessa enrolled in the University of Miami School of Law but found her knack for poker outweighed her legal ambitions. Despite leaving her studies, she eventually took the bar exam in 2018 and earned her legal credentials.

Poker Journey Unfolds

Vanessa’s poker journey commenced in 2006, securing the 5th place in a WSOP Circuit tournament in Atlantic City. She became the youngest female poker player to reach a WSOPC final table. Over the years, Vanessa participated in numerous tournaments, achieving notable success, including a victory at the European High Roller Championship in 2009, where she claimed €532,500 (approximately $700,160).

PokerStars Sponsorship and Beyond

In 2007, Vanessa caught the attention of PokerStars, leading to a sponsorship deal. This collaboration not only brought her global recognition but also provided opportunities to meet renowned professionals. However, in 2015, Vanessa chose not to renew her contract with PokerStars, steering her journey in a new direction.

Beyond Poker: Vanessa’s DJ Venture

Presently, Vanessa Russo, alongside her partner, is exploring the realm of DJing. Engaging in new musical projects and releasing original tracks, “Lady Maverick” is showcasing her diverse talents. Despite her musical pursuits, Vanessa affirms that poker will always be an integral part of her life.

Fascinating Facts about Vanessa Russo

  • Vanessa was born in White Plains, New York, and spent part of her childhood in Paris, France.
  • Fluent in both English and French, Vanessa holds dual citizenship in France and the USA.
  • During her university years, she was part of the National Honor’s Society, Debate Club, and Mothers Against Drunk Driving organization.
  • In 2007, Vanessa traveled to Washington to support the Poker Players Alliance in challenging the 2006 law on online gambling.
  • Vanessa opened the “Big Slick Boot Camp” for poker training in Florida in 2009, charging $400 for the sessions.
  • Vanessa was married to poker player Chad Brown for three years until his passing.
  • She participated in a photoshoot in the Bahamas for “Sports Illustrated,” earning a spot on the list of the top 20 sexiest poker players by “Maxim” magazine.
  • Vanessa appeared in the 17th season of the TV show “Big Brother.”
  • Vanessa openly declared her non-traditional orientation and is currently in a relationship with Melissa Welly.
  • Vanessa and Melissa formed a DJ duo named N1TEL1TE and collaborate on producing music.
  • In the fall of 2019, Vanessa and Melissa announced they were expecting additions to their family, with Vanessa giving birth to twins, London and Lorenzo, in the spring of 2020, while Melissa welcomed a son named Lucas 2.5 weeks earlier.
